Convertible - Pull Down Handle Uncomfortably Warm

Introduction
The No.1 bow pull-down handle on the 2000 model year Solara Convertible may, in some instances, become uncomfortably warm if left in direct sun for extended periods. To help insulate the handle, a felt pad can be added as explained in the following procedure.
Applicable Vehicles
^ 2000 model year Solara Convertible.

Warranty Information
Applicable Warranty*:
This repair is covered under the Toyota Basic Warranty. This warranty is in effect for 36 months or 36,000 miles, whichever occurs first, from the vehicle's in-service date.
* Warranty application is limited to correction of a problem based upon a customer's specific complaint.
Application Procedure
Apply felt pad material to the center pull-down handle of the No. 1 bow.
1. Remove the 6 screws (shown in illustration) to gain access to the center pull-down handle.
2. Pull up the black plastic cover of the No. 1 bow to gain access to the underside of the center pull-down handle.
3. Apply the felt pad to the underside of the pull-down handle.
A. Fold felt pad along dotted line.
B. Apply to the handle as shown in illustration. Fold should line up with edge of pull-down handle.
4. Reinstall screws.
